docker - 如何在docker中添加文件
问题描述
我是 docker 新手,我按照官方网站提供的说明安装了 docker。
# build docker images
docker build -t iky_backend:2.0.0 .
docker build -t iky_gateway:2.0.0 frontend/.
现在,当我在安装 docker 后在终端中运行这些命令时,我收到以下错误。我也尝试添加sudo
。但是没有用。
无法准备上下文:无法评估 Dockerfile 路径中的符号链接:lstat /home/esh/Dockerfile:没有这样的文件或目录
解决方案
您docker images
应该执行得很好(如果您无法连接到 docker daemon,可能需要 sudo)。
docker build
需要 aDockerfile
出现在同一目录中(您正在主文件夹中执行 - 不要那样做),或者您需要使用-f
来指定路径而不是 .
尝试这个:
mkdir build
cd build
在此处创建您的 Dockerfile。
docker build -t iky_backend:2.0.0 .
docker images
推荐阅读
- jython - Maximo Automation 脚本记录脚本崩溃
- java - 无法在 android 中创建我的视图模型类的实例
- javascript - 用于检测浏览器外部链接的 Google Chrome 扩展程序
- python - 如何更有效地解码 RSA 加密?
- c - 调用另一个函数并使其直接返回给该函数的调用者
- r - 将 Excel 文件中的表抓取到 R 中
- r - 如何分隔从 Excel 电子表格导入的列以创建多个单独的列表
- php - 从收藏夹中删除产品时出错(我自己创建了愿望清单系统)
- google-app-engine - 如何在 gcp 上部署 angular-spring-postgres 应用程序?
- openapi - OpenAPI - 参数名称值可以包含“>”字符吗?